Went out to pick up my S&W 642 today and took a look at this shotgun. Fit and finished looked ok for a $350 gun and was wondering if anyone out there had one, or a chance to shoot one? Also looked at the Win X-2 and was wondering if it would be better to save my pennies for a step up in quaility? Thanks
 
The Baikal is an excellent gun for the money: tough, overbuilt almost to a fault, and should last forever if you look after it. However, the three I've shot (they're quite popular among duck hunters here) were not as comfortable to shoot as the Winchester/Remington/Mossberg alternatives; the fit and finish were not in the same league; and the chokes that come with the gun did not seem to give particularly good patterns. If I were in your shoes, I'd save up for the Winchester - but I can't deny that for something less than half the price, the Baikal is a bargain. You get what you pay for...
